I have the same thing as TS. I have finally succumbed and have taken it apart and viciously attacked it with a soldering iron.
Shown below, on the left, is the original circuit and, on the right, the addition of a 22k pot which works nicely as a volume control.
[EDIT] If trying this modification, I recommend unsoldering the speaker wires from the circuit board not from the piezo disc.

2- How is it that a light bulb could be used for testing? Sounds interesting.
A lightbulb is a fancy resistor, it can emit light in proportion to the current flowing through it, and its resistance increases with current (temperature, actually) which makes it somewhat self-protecting. It's relatively low ohms (making it not such a good choice after we see @AlbertHall 's info) and is built to handle power dissipation.
